attack of the birds! Venice, Crystal River & Orlando. That's what this trip entailed.
When we signed up for our phone service a year prior, they had a one day special. That special was that if you signed up for service, faithfully paid your bills, then in a year you would get a free plane ticket. We may not always be frugal, but we love free stuff! Who doesn't? With the free ticket you could choose from a number of destinations. We opted for Florida because Jeff's grandparents live there plus we wanted to act like children for a day in Orlando.
After landing in Orlando we hopped in the rental car and drove to visit Jeff's grandma Margaret in Venice. She showed us a great time! We went to the beach, ate Thanksgiving dinner with her neighborhood, took walks along the pier, watched a sunset, saw a dolphin and Jeff even searched for fossilized shark teeth. Venice is known for the abundance of shark teeth and Jeff braved the 62 degree F waters in search of them. *Success!
After a few days in Venice, we ventured north to Crystal River where we stayed with Jeff's grandma Rutherford. While there we went
to a beach that was swarming with birds. They were everywhere! It was out of this world to have so many flying around us! We managed to get out of there without a poop-on-head incident😉 We enjoyed one rainy day indoors, talking & enjoying eachother's company.
Then we headed back to Orlando and decided to go to Universal Studios. Damn those tickets are expensive! However, we had a lot of fun riding the rides and rollercoasters. Our favorite by far though, was Seuss Landing. It was like stepping into a real life Dr. Seuss book. What a whimsical place!
